Tumbling
Many people question cheerleading, and say, "Isn't cheerleading basically gymnastics?" The answer is yes, it is similar when it comes to tumbling. But, there are no stunts or dances in gymnastics. Tumbling is consisted of flips, such as back-handsprings, fulls, double fulls, punch fronts, back tucks, layouts, round-off, and so many more tricks. For example, level 1 tumbling contains simple skills, such as a roll, cartwheel, back-walkover and front-walkover. Then, as the level increases, the difficulty of the tumbling and stunts increases. Tumbling may look cool and is fun to do, but you can get very hurt, and for some people, it takes a while to get a skill down.
